This dataset contains the data used for the paper titled "Toward quantifying turbulent vertical airflow and sensible heat flux in tall forest canopies using fiber-optic distributed temperature sensing". This first part of the dataset contains the experiment conducted between April 2020 and June 2020 at the Ecological Botanical Garden (EBG) at the University of Bayreuth. Two upside-down sonic anemometers (Model USA-1, Metek GmbH, Elmshorn, Germany) at 1.5 m height (middle of the shroud) and two quad disk pressure ports attached to a nano resolution digital barometer (Model 745-16B, Paroscientific, Inc.) at 1 m above ground set up; one of each sensor placed inside the cylindrical shroud. The sonic anemometer and static pressure data recorded at sampling frequencies of 20 Hz. The second part of the dataset contains the experiment conducted at the Waldstein-Weidenbrunnen long-term ecosystem flux site between October 2020 and November 2020 as part of the LOEWE20 (Large Eddy ObsErvatory Walsstein Experiment 2020) experiment. Two high-resolution DTS instruments (Model 5 km Ultima, Silixa, London, UK) used to observe the continuous temperature with a spatial resolution of 0.127 m averaged over 6 seconds. Quartet FO array containing two pairs of parallel coned and unconed FO cables extending from the ground to the top canopy at 34 m and 36m height for main and turbulence tower.
